e.i.

Hello!

I’m esosa, a miami-based software engineer who loves humanizing tech & solving people problems.

Get in touch

BACKGROUND

I'm currently a rising senior at the University of Miami, where I am pursuing a degree in Computer Science with a minor in the Music Industry. With three years of experience in front-end coding, I specialize in creating engaging and user-friendly web interfaces. I'm passionate about enhancing my coding abilities and actively seek freelance and volunteer opportunities to further refine my skills.

As a software engineer, I strive to bridge the gap between technical functionality and aesthetic design, creating seamless and visually appealing web applications. My goal is to deliver pixel-perfect user experiences while ensuring the underlying code is efficient and scalable.

When I'm not in front of a computer screen, You can find me playing the piano, sewing, baking, or on the beach looking for rare shells.

SKILLS

FRAMEWORKS

  • React
  • Express
  • Jekyll
  • Wordpress

TOOLS

  • Git & GitHub
  • Chrome DevTools
  • VSCode
  • MongoDb

DESIGN

  • Photoshop
  • Figma
  • InDesign
  • Prototyping
  • Wireframing
  • User Testing

LANGUAGES

  • JavaScript (ES6)
  • Java
  • HTML
  • CSS/Sass
  • Python
  • SQL
  • C++, C#, C

DESIGN

ArtistNotes

ArtistNotes is a music listening app that lets artists upload their music and accompanying notes, offering a personalized experience for managing and sharing their creative work. Artists can also upload images alongside their tracks, providing a multimedia approach to their music portfolio.

RECENT PROJECTS

My first portfolio website was a conscious design effort that taught me a lot about HTML, CSS, and information architecture.

  • JavaScript
  • HTML
  • CSS

Voluntarily built AfroXDance's club website using Express, featuring integration with the MailChimp API for the club's digital marketing needs.

  • JavaScript
  • jQuery
  • Mailchimp API
  • Node.js
  • HTML
  • CSS
  • Express
ArtistNotes

ArtistNotes is a web app that empowers artists to upload their own music and accompanying notes, providing a personalized way to manage their creative work. With the ability to add images alongside their tracks, artists can create a multimedia portfolio of their music.

  • React
  • Sass
  • Firebase
  • Google Drive API